You decide to sell short 260 shares at a price of $76.43 each. The inital margin is 50%. For this question, assume that the lending rate associated with the borrowed shares is 0% and that your cash earns no interest when held by your broker.

Part 1

How much of your own money do you have to contribute to the account,?

Part 2

If the price rises to $88.64 after 10 months, what is your new margin ratio (expressed as a decimal)?
